Cascarones Spontaneous-Crack-A-Thon at Woodmere!

July 25 @ 10:00 am - 3:00 pm
Free

Join Woodmere Art Museum for a festive day celebrating the colorful tradition of cascarones, confetti-filled eggs that are cracked over the heads of friends and loved ones to bring good luck. In partnership with Philadelphia artist Marta Sánchez and Cascarones Por La Vida, this family festival will feature hands-on artmaking in celebration of culture and creativity.

From 10:00 AM–12:00 PM, families are invited to participate in free cascarón decorating workshop in the MacDonald Studio. Guests will learn about the history and significance of this beloved tradition while creating their own colorful designs.

At 12:00 PM, guests will gather for a community celebration featuring remarks from special guests, volunteers, and organizations whose support has helped make this event possible.

The highlight of the day begins at 2:00 PM with the Cascarones Spontaneous-Crack-A-Thon, a large-scale community participation event and official attempt to set a Guinness World Record for the largest simultaneous cascarón cracking. Registered participants will receive two complimentary cascarones and gather for a coordinated countdown before cracking them overhead at the same moment. Combining the joy of a cherished cultural tradition with the excitement of a world record attempt, this memorable event will bring hundreds of participants together in a shared celebration of art, community, and good fortune.

This event is free and open to all ages. Registration is encouraged.
